Fidel Castro wrote on a state run Cuban website “I expressed that personally I had not the least doubt of the honesty with which Obama, the 11th president since 1 January, 1959, expressed his ideas, but in spite of his noble intentions there remained many questions to answer.” Fidel’s brother, Raul had previously said that he thought Obama seemed like a good man and wished him good luck.
